Sony Alpha 77
The Sony α77 was the flagship for Sony's midrange Alpha SLT camera line. The successor to the Sony A700, it is equipped with a 24.3 MP APS-C HD CMOS sensor and has a 12-fps burst-shooting mode. The camera is fitted with Sony's patented “translucent mirror” technology. On 1 May 2014 its replacement, the α77 II (ILCA-77M2) was announced with availability in June. Model variants Model variants of the α77 camera body: * SLT-A77V with GPS. * SLT-A77 without GPS (depending on country). Depending on country/market, the α77 camera is also available in different kits: * SLT-A77VQ (α77V+ 16-50mm lens). * SLT-A77VK (α77V+ 18-55mm lens). * SLT-A77VM (α77V+ 18-135mm lens). Lens mount Sony Alpha SLT-A77 uses A-mount lens bayonet. Features Image features * 24.3 megapixel Exmor APS-C HD CMOS sensor. * Updated BIONZ Image Processor. * 2nd generation Translucent Mirror Technology. * Multi-frame Noise Reduction. Sony SLT Camera
Single-lens translucent (SLT) is a Sony proprietary designation for Sony Alpha cameras which employ a pellicle mirror, electronic viewfinder, and phase-detection autofocus system. They employ the same Minolta A-mount as Sony Alpha DSLR cameras. Sony SLT cameras have a semi-transparent fixed mirror which diverts a portion of incoming light to a phase-detection autofocus sensor, while the remaining light strikes a digital image sensor. The image sensor feeds the electronic viewfinder, and also records still images and video on command. The utility of the SLT design is to allow full-time phase-detection autofocus during electronic viewfinder, live view, and video recording operation. 1080p24
1080p (1920×1080 progressively displayed pixels; also known as Full HD or FHD, and BT.709) is a set of HDTV high-definition video modes characterized by 1,920 pixels displayed across the screen horizontally and 1,080 pixels down the screen vertically; the ''p'' stands for progressive scan, ''i.e.'' non-interlaced. The term usually assumes a widescreen aspect ratio of 16:9, implying a resolution of 2.1 megapixels. It is often marketed as Full HD or FHD, to contrast 1080p with 720p resolution screens. Although 1080p is sometimes informally referred to as 2K, these terms reflect two distinct technical standards, with differences including resolution and aspect ratio. 1080p video signals are supported by ATSC standards in the United States and DVB standards in Europe. BIONZ X
BIONZ is a line of image processors used in Sony digital cameras. It is currently used in many Sony α DSLR and mirrorless cameras. Image processing in the camera converts the raw data from a CCD or CMOS image sensor into the format that is stored on the memory card. This processing is one of the bottlenecks in digital camera speed, so manufacturers put much effort into making, and marketing, the fastest processors for this step that they can. Sony designs the circuitry of the processor in-house, and outsources the manufacturing to semiconductor foundries such as MegaChips and (mostly) GlobalFoundries, as they currently do not own any fabrication plant capable of producing a system on a chip (SoC). Sony also sources DRAM chips from various manufacturers namely Samsung, SK Hynix and Micron Technology. BIONZ utilizes two chips in its design. Digital Photography Review
''Digital Photography Review'', also known as ''DPReview,'' is a website about digital cameras and digital photography, established in November 1998. The website provides comprehensive reviews of digital cameras, lenses and accessories, buying guides, user reviews, and forums for individual cameras, as well as general photography forums. The website also has a database with information about individual digital cameras, lenses, printers and imaging applications. Originally based in London, ''Digital Photography Review'' and most of its team relocated to Seattle, Washington, in 2010. It is currently owned by Amazon. Main features ''DPReview'' has regularly published thorough, technically orientated camera reviews since the website launched in 1998. Sony Alpha 900
The α900 (DSLR-A900) is a full-frame digital SLR camera, produced by Sony. An early design study of the camera was shown at PMA on 8 March 2007, and a newer prototype announced at PMA 2008 on 31 January 2008. Sony officially introduced the final camera on 9 September 2008 prior to photokina 2008. In October 2011, Sony Japan announced the camera's end of production. The specifications include: 24.6-megapixel CMOS sensor, 5 frame/s burst mode, dual BIONZ processors, 100% viewfinder, 9-point AF with 10 assist points, inbuilt image sensor shift stabilization and intelligent preview. It does not have video/movie recording. Intelligent preview mode This mode, first introduced on the DSLR-A900, allows the photographer to take a sample image at the current settings. When this mode is enabled in the settings (default), then using the depth of field (DOF) preview button makes a preview image of the subject. DxOMark
DxOMark, currently stylized as DXOMARK, is a commercial website described as "an independent benchmark that scientifically assesses smartphones, lenses and cameras". Founded in 2008, DxOMark was originally owned by DxO Labs, a French engineering and consulting company, which is headquartered in Boulogne-Billancourt, Paris, France. DxOMark Image Labs was separated from DxO Labs in September 2017, and was later re-branded to DxOMark in 2019. DxOMark is now a wholly independent privately-owned company.
